In an attempt to recruit a large number of workers for their new megastore in Australia, IKEA amusingly decided to include what they called ‘Career Instructions’ into each of their flat packs. Based on their traditional furniture instructions, all customers took home the witty application forms without realising. The clever initiative not only minimised the costs on advertising, but it also ensured IKEA fans were targeted.

3. IKEA
• IKEA has often received “great place
to work”-type awards from various
institutions and its turnover
happens to be much lower than its
competitors. A part of this success
is explained by the company by
their flat organizational structure
that encourages personal initiatives
and employee empowerment.
4. IKEA
• IKEA is also well known for having a
strong culture that promotes work-life
balance, work flexibility, diversity and
creativity, which also reinforces their
recognition as employer. The company
also has a very innovative approach to
HR management that contributes to
their success, but some of its HR
innovative practices are a bit less known
out of the company.

9. RESULTS
• The campaign brought in
4,285 job applicants,
resulting in 280 new hires
for their megastore.
